CPR Saves Lives!

According to the CDC (Center for Disease Control and Prevention) “about 350,000 cardiac arrests happen outside of hospitals each year” and currently, about 90% of these result in death. CPR can help improve these odds. When CPR is performed within the first few minutes of cardiac arrest, it can double or triple a person’s chance of survival!

BLS for Healthcare Professionals

This course is for licensed or non-licensed healthcare providers. It is needed for EMT/EMT Students, Paramedics, Nursing Assistants, CNA, LPN, RN, Nursing Students, Physician Assistants, Dentists, Physicians, Pharmacist Immunization License and all personnel in the HealthCare Field.

The BLS course covers the following:

  • Adult, child, and pediatric/infant CPR
  • Foreign body airway obstruction
  • Two rescuer scenarios with use of a barrier protection (pocket mask) and a bag valve mask ventilation (BVM’s)
  • Use of the Automated External Defibrillator (AED)

Students receive an AHA-approved “BLS for Healthcare Providers” course completion card which is good for 2 years.

Fully in-person classes are approximately 3.5 hours.
Skills practice/skills exam only classes are approximately 1.5 hours.

Heartsaver
CPR AED

The Heartsaver CPR/AED course is intended for all individuals who have a duty to respond to a cardiac emergency because of job responsibilities or regulatory requirements. It is also for rescuers who want to learn the knowledge necessary to help someone in cardiac arrest.

This course is NOT for EMT/EMT Students, Paramedics, Nursing Assistants, CNA, LPN, RN, Nursing Students, Physician Assistants, Dentists, Physicians, Pharmacist Immunization License and all personnel in the HealthCare Field. These professions are required to take the BLS class.

The Heartsaver CPR/AED class covers the following:

  • Adult, child, and infant CPR

  • Use of a pocket face mask

  • Foreign body airway obstruction

  • Use of the Automated External Defibrillator (AED)

Students will receive an AHA-approved Heartsaver CPR/AED course completion card which is good for 2 years. This is applicable to any of the options below.

Fully in-person classes are approximately 2.5 hours.

Skills practice/skills exam only classes are approximately 1.5 hours.
